The NEW Irondequoit Fire District is made up of the previous Laurelton and Ridge-Culver Fire Districts and their respective Fire Associations and Labor Unions. The merge of the two fire districts happened in May of 2022, but the Fire Associations remain separate.
The mission of the Ridge-Culver Volunteer Fire Association is to support Fire Department Operations, provide a gateway for members to become volunteer firefighters, recognize and honor our past members for their dedicated service and create an inclusive social environment for members, families, and guests. This has been our basic mission since 1921 and will continue with your support. We are very proud of our long-standing tradition and participation in the Irondequoit community.
